Conversion Formula for Milligram Per Minute to Kilogram Per Second
The formula of conversion of Milligram Per Minute to Kilogram Per Second is very simple. To convert Milligram Per Minute to Kilogram Per Second, we can use this simple formula:
1 Milligram Per Minute = 0.0000000167 Kilogram Per Second
1 Kilogram Per Second = 60,000,000 Milligram Per Minute
One Milligram Per Minute is equal to 0.0000000167 Kilogram Per Second. So, we need to multiply the number of Milligram Per Minute by 0.0000000167 to get the no of Kilogram Per Second. This formula helps when we need to change the measurements from Milligram Per Minute to Kilogram Per Second

Details for Milligram per Minute (Controlled Low Mass Flow)
Introduction : The milligram per minute is used to express small but sustained mass flows, useful in applications where dosing or release must occur slowly and steadily. It helps monitor and control systems that need precision at milligram levels over longer durations.
History & Origin : Built from the milligram and minute, this unit evolved with the growing demand for precision in time-sensitive chemical and medical processes. It offered an intermediate alternative to mg/s for use cases where second-by-second resolution was not necessary.
Current Use : It finds applications in IV drip settings, slow-release drug systems, and micro-manufacturing where constant material output must be monitored. Engineers and lab technicians use mg/min when balancing accuracy with manageable timing intervals for continuous low-level flow.
Details for Kilogram per Second (SI Mass Flow Rate Unit)
Introduction : The kilogram per second is the SI base unit for mass flow rate, expressing how many kilograms pass through a system each second. It is a direct and efficient unit used in various scientific and engineering contexts, especially where large or precise mass flows need to be quantified over time.
History & Origin : As part of the SI system standardized in the 20th century, the kilogram per second emerged from the need to represent mass transfer in a time-dependent manner. It is built upon the kilogram, the SI base unit of mass, and the second, the SI base unit of time.
Current Use : Widely used in fluid mechanics, chemical processing, and thermal engineering, the kg/s unit helps quantify high-speed conveyor outputs, pump rates, and fuel mass flows in engines. It plays a vital role in industrial-scale manufacturing and large-scale simulations involving continuous mass transfer.
